Trip Overview

This 102.4-mile drive from Baldwin, LA to Kenner, LA is a straightforward, highway-focused journey that can easily be completed in under two hours. With a fuel cost estimated at $15, it’s an economical option for a day trip. The route primarily utilizes US 90 and I-10, offering a quick connection between these two points in Southeast Louisiana. Since there are no designated stops and the drive is relatively short, you won't need to break it up into multiple days. It's a practical choice for getting from point A to point B efficiently.

What kind of drive is this?

Expect a predominantly highway experience on this route, with 97% of the drive taking place on major roads. You'll spend a significant portion of the journey on US 90, which forms the longest uninterrupted stretch at 84.9 miles. The transition to I-310 and then I-10 will offer a more interstate-style driving environment as you approach Kenner. This is a drive designed for covering distance with minimal interruption, so the road character is consistent and geared towards forward momentum.

About the Cities

Arriving in Kenner, LA

Full guide →

Kenner is a suburb of New Orleans, Louisiana, on the east bank of Jefferson Parish, approximately 10 mi (16 km) west of the city. It is the location of New Orleans International Airport. René-Robert Cavelier landed on this stretch of the north shore of the Mississippi River in 1682.
